P20BE Meaning

The P20BE fault code signals that reductant heater ‘B’ is not performing as expected. This could lead to problems in the vehicle’s emission reduction system. Performance issues may stem from a malfunction in the heater itself, wiring problems, or a control module fault, affecting the heater’s ability to function effectively.

Step-by-step diagnostic guide

ActionDescriptionTools Needed
Check for Other CodesUse an OBD-II scanner to search for related codes that may help diagnose the performance issue.OBD-II Scanner
Test the Performance of Heater ‘B’Use a diagnostic tool to test the performance of reductant heater ‘B’ and ensure it meets the manufacturer’s specifications.Multimeter, Diagnostic Tool
Inspect the HeaterVisually inspect heater ‘B’ for any signs of damage or wear that could affect performance.Flashlight, Multimeter
Check the Control ModuleVerify that the control module is working properly and that it is sending the correct signals to the heater.Diagnostic Tool
Repair or Replace HeaterIf heater performance is below specification, repair or replace the unit as needed.Replacement Heater, Tools
Clear the Code and Test DriveAfter repairs, clear the code using an OBD-II scanner and test drive the vehicle to verify the problem is resolved.OBD-II Scanner, Vehicle Manual
Recheck for CodesAfter the test drive, rescan the vehicle to ensure the P20BE code does not reappear.OBD-II Scanner
